Herr's Chips: A Deep Dive into Flavors & History
Herr's potato crisps boast a rich history rooted in small-town Pennsylvania. Established in 1956 by Jim Herr, the independent business began with a modest goal: to create tasty potato crisps. Over the decades, Herr's has developed its flavor profile, moving past the traditional original variety to include a substantial range of unique options. Now, consumers can enjoy such unique tastes as Jalapeño, Buffalo Wing Cheese, and Sweet Chocolate Wonderful Potato Crisps. Herr's dedication to incorporating premium materials and preserving a classic baking method has led to their lasting popularity.
